Main Symbols Woven In
| Lion | A symbol of strength and a guardian deity for the home. |
| Goat (Sheep) | The symbol of goats, which are property for Iranian nomads. It represents a wish for prosperity. |
| Tree of Life | The tree symbol is called the Tree of Life and represents wishes for health and longevity. |
Features of Persian Hand-woven Gabbeh Rugs
Gabbeh rugs are long-pile rugs made from plant-dyed wool, hand-woven by the Qashqai tribe who nomadize in Iran's Zagros Mountains, deeply rooted in their daily lives. The Persian Variant wool used in this product has excellent durability to survive in the harsh environment of the Zagros Mountains and contains a lot of oil to effectively regulate body temperature, resulting in a soft and pleasant texture.
Gabbeh rugs, woven meticulously by hand, strand by strand, by Iranian nomads after dyeing the wool with natural dyes, are characterized by their fluffy and pleasant feel.
Well-woven Gabbeh rugs are said to last for 100 years, boasting superior durability.
Born from a climate with extreme temperature differences between day and night, Gabbeh rugs also have the characteristic of being warm in winter and well-ventilated in summer, preventing feelings of heat.
And above all, there is its artistry. Gabbeh rugs created from the imagination of nomads often feature designs of animals and plants, with each one being a unique, original item.
They can be laid on the floor or even hung on a wall as art.

Daily Care
Remove dirt and dust with a vacuum cleaner or broom along the pile.
If concerned about stains: Dilute a neutral detergent (for wool/silk) with water, wring out a towel tightly, and gently wipe the surface. Then, wipe thoroughly with a damp cloth to remove the detergent and dry in a well-ventilated, shaded area.
